Yesterday's Idea!
I needed a roof extention to cover a new item outside. Do I really want to spend that much money? (Who does?)
I decided I could more easilly just raise a roof I already have that is portable and on wheels. It's corrugated galvenised steel on a steel tube framework, supported by a steel tube frame on lockable casters. I just cut 4 pieces of 1" galvenised pipe, drill 8 holes and extend the thing to do what I need done.
Extra added savings, it's not adding to my real estate taxes because it's on wheels!
Property taxes are something to think about because they Never go away, they just keep increasing.
